Realities Beyond Our Perception
Our cognition of the universe is inherently limited by our physical limitations. We are confined to three spatial dimensions and one dimension of time, a framework that shapes our experience. Yet, mathematics hints at the possibility of dimensions transcending our awareness.
Speculations like string theory and M-theory propose the presence of extra spatial dimensions, curled at scales too small for us to detect. These realities could contribute to the fundamental forces of nature and contain secrets about the origin and evolution of the cosmos.
Exploring these spectra remains a ambitious task, requiring novel approaches to mathematics. Nevertheless, the opportunity for discovery is immense, pushing the limits of our knowledge.
